A new species of the monotypic genus Pseudohypocrea is described based on a collection from Tai Po Kau, Hong Kong, China. The fungus is characterized by globose to subglobose perithecia entirely immersed in a pulvinate reddish-brown stroma, cylindrical asci with smooth-walled and lemon-shaped part-ascospores, and occurring on dead leaves. Morphological features of the new species are described and compared with the only known species of the genus.poi  相似文献

Abstract. The ant genus lshakidris from Sarawak is described as new. Its relationships with the Brasilian monotypic genus Phalacromyrmex Kempf and the Malagasy monotypic genus Pilotrochus Brown are discussed, and the Phalacromyrmex genus-group is established to hold the three genera. The resemblances of lshakidris to the smithistrumiform dacetine genus Glamymmyrmex Wheeler and the agroecomyrmecine genus Tatuidris Brown & Kempf are discussed and the similarities are analysed as the results of convergence in the characters concerned.  相似文献

The fossil species Architipula fragmentosa (Bode) comb. nov. (Diptera: Nematocera: Limoniidae) from the German Upper Lias (Lower Jurassic) is redescribed. This species was originally described by Bode (1953) in a new monotypic genus as Eoasilidea fragmentosa and placed in the Brachycera, with Eoasilidea as the type-genus of a new family Eoasilidae. This family is here synonymized with the Limoniidae (Nematocera), and the genus Eoasilidea is synonymized with Architipula Handlirsch .  相似文献

This paper constitutes a revisionary treatment of the Encyrtid subtribe Dinocarsiina as defined by Kerrich (1967). The genera there listed are studied, together with Praleurocerus Agarwal and Aeptencyrtus De Santis, which are here included. Encyrtolophus De Santis is treated as a subgenus of Chrysoplatycerus Ashmead although it is very distinct from the type species of that genus. A new genus is proposed for Tropidophryne flandersi Compare. All specíes are redescribed with exception of two belonging to monotypic genera. Five species are described as new.  相似文献

Pollen grains from 15 species (18 taxa) of the genus Filipendula were examined with light and scan-ning electron microscopy. It was revealed that the pollen grains are isopolar, tricolporate, with scabrate or scabrate-microechinate surface. The pollen morphology was compared with the conventional classification sys-tems of the genus by different authors, and supported Shimizu's system (1961), in which the genus was divided into three subgenera. The monotypic subgen. Hypogyna is characterized by pollen lacking fastigium and thickened costae colpi. The other monotypic subgen. Filipendula differs from others by pollen having larger grain, larger pore size, longitudinally elliptic fastigium and thickened costae colpi. The largest subgen. Ulmaria is distinguished by pollen having rounded or latitudinally elliptic fastigium and thickened costae colpi. Sectional classification was not supported by the pollen morphology due to insufficient variability.  相似文献

Available data on the tetramoriine ant genus Rhoptromyrmex Mayr are reviewed. The genus is redefined for all castes and the monotypic genus Hagioxenus Forel, formerly placed in the Monomorium-group , is synonymized with Rhoptromyrmex. A new species (caritus) is described from Uganda and keys to known workers, females and males are presented. Nest founding by the females, two of which appear autoparasitic and two of which are inquilines, is discussed and the evolutionary pathway of inquilines reviewed. Current taxonomic data on all species are summarized.  相似文献

A hypothesis (CI=57.3%) on the evolutionary relationships of families comprising the class Monogenoidea is proposed based on 141 character states in 47 homologous series and employing phylogenetic systematics. Based on the analysis, three subclasses, the Polyonchoinea, Polystomatoinea and Oligonchoinea, are recognised. The analysis supports independent origins of the Montchadskyellidae within the Polyonchoinea and of the Neodactylodiscidae and Amphibdellatidae within the order Dactylogyridea (Polyonchoinea); the suborder Montchadskyellinea is raised to ordinal status and new suborders Neodactylodiscinea and Amphibdellatinea are proposed to reflect these origins. The Gyrodactylidea (Polyonchoinea) is supported by three synapomorphies and comprises the Gyrodactylidae, Anoplodiscidae, Tetraonchoididae and Bothitrematidae. The analysis supports recognition of the Polystomatoinea comprising Polystomatidae and Sphyranuridae. Evolutionary relationships within the Oligonchoinea indicate independent origins of three ordinal taxa, the Chimaericolidea (monotypic), Diclybothriidea (including Diclybothriidae and Hexabothriidae) and Mazocraeidea (with five suborders). The suborder Mazocraeinea comprises the Plectanocotylidae, Mazocraeidae and Mazoplectidae, and is characterised by two synapomorphies. The suborder Gastrocotylinea, characterised by presence of accessory sclerites in the haptoral sucker, is divided into two infraorders, the monotypic Anthocotylina infraorder novum and Gastrocotylina. Two superfamilies of the Gastrocotylina are recognised, the Protomicrocotyloidea and Gastrocotyloidea; the Pseudodiclidophoridae is considered incertae sedis within the Gastrocotylina. The suborder Discocotylinea comprises the Discocotylidae, Octomacridae and Diplozoidae and is supported by four synapomorphies. The monotypic Hexostomatinea suborder novum is proposed to reflect an independent origin of the Hexostomatidae within the Mazocraeidea. The terminal suborder Microcotylinea comprises four superfamilies, the Microcotyloidea, Allopyragraphoroidea, Diclidophoroidea and Pyragraphoroidea. The analysis supports incorporation of the Pterinotrematidae in the Pyragraphoroidea and rejection of the monotypic order Pterinotrematidea. The following taxa are also rejected for reasons of paraphyly and/or polyphyly: Articulonchoinea, Bothriocotylea, Eucotylea, Monoaxonematidea, Tetraonchidea, Gotocotyloidea, Anchorophoridae and Macrovalvitrematidae. The Sundanonchidae, Iagotrematidae and Microbothriidae were not included in the analysis because of lack of pertinent information regarding character states.  相似文献

A new bufonid amphibian, belonging to a new monotypic genus, is described from the Andaman Islands, in the Bay of Bengal, Republic of India, based on unique external morphological and skeletal characters which are compared with those of known Oriental and other relevant bufonid genera. Blythophryne gen. n. is distinguished from other bufonid genera by its small adult size (mean SVL 24.02 mm), the presence of six presacral vertebrae, an absence of coccygeal expansions, presence of an elongated pair of parotoid glands, expanded discs at digit tips and phytotelmonous tadpoles that lack oral denticles. The taxonomic and phylogenetic position of the new taxon (that we named as Blythophryne beryet gen. et sp. n.) was ascertained by comparing its 12S and 16S partial genes with those of Oriental and other relevant bufonid lineages. Resulting molecular phylogeny supports the erection of a novel monotypic genus for this lineage from the Andaman Islands of India.  相似文献

CRISP, M. D. & TAYLOR, J. M., 1990. A new species of Bentleya E. Bennett (Pittosporaceae) from southern Western Australia. Hitherto Bentleya has been a monotypic genus known from a restricted area in south-west Western Australia. This paper describes a second species which was discovered recently in the same region. The new species differs from B. spinescens in its remarkable habit but shares with it several floral characters which are unique within the family.  相似文献
